About
Usman Khan is a leading figure in the field of stereotactic laser ablation (SLA) for neurosurgery, with a primary focus on improving the safety and procedural outcomes of minimally invasive brain surgery. His major contributions center on advancing the clinical application of the NeuroBlate system, particularly through his pivotal work on the LAANTERN (Laser Ablation of Abnormal Neurological Tissue Using Robotic Neuroblate System) study. This landmark investigation, which has garnered over 42 citations, provided critical prospective data on the safety profile of SLA for treating a range of difficult-to-manage intracranial pathologies, including epilepsy and brain tumors. By demonstrating the procedure's favorable hospitalization metrics and low complication rates, Khan’s research has helped validate SLA as a viable alternative to traditional open craniotomy, reducing patient recovery times and surgical risks. His work is widely recognized for bridging the gap between early retrospective reports and robust, multi-institutional evidence, establishing foundational benchmarks for procedural safety that guide neurosurgeons worldwide.
